API: De digitale voordelen van het koppelen van software

Een API is een digitale interface tussen twee systemen. Zij maken het mogelijk dat een systeem met een ander communiceert. Zo kunnen gegevens worden uitgewisseld en taken worden geautomatiseerd. Dit is enorm waardevol maakt voor bedrijven die bezig zijn met het inrichten van een digitaal ecosysteem. API’s helpen snel kennis te delen; bieden een gemeenschappelijke taal om verschillende softwareprogramma’s met elkaar kunnen werken en nieuwe markten door anderen toegang te geven tot uw hulpbronnen.

Meer weten?

Ga het gesprek aan met Koen!

1. Wat is een API

API staat voor Application Programming Interface (toepassingsprogramma-interface). Het is een digitale interface die twee systemen in staat stelt met elkaar te communiceren. Met een API kunnen gegevens worden uitgewisseld en taken worden uitgevoerd zonder menselijke tussenkomst. Dat maakt API’s tot een waardevol instrument voor bedrijven, omdat ze helpen om sneller kennis uit te wisselen en nieuwe markten te ontsluiten. Er zijn veel verschillende soorten API-interfaces, dus bedrijven kunnen er een vinden die het best bij hun behoeften past.

2. Waarom zijn API’s belangrijk om in uw digitaal ecosysteem te hebben

API’s zijn belangrijk om in je digitale ecosysteem te hebben, omdat ze een manier bieden om verschillende delen van uw digitale wereld met elkaar te verbinden. Door API’s te hebben, kun je het voor verschillende toepassingen en diensten gemakkelijker maken om samen te werken. Dat kan om een aantal redenen nuttig zijn, bijvoorbeeld om het gemakkelijker te maken gegevens te delen tussen verschillende toepassingen, of om verschillende toepassingen te laten samenwerken om een completere ervaring voor de gebruiker te creëren.

API’s kunnen ook commerciële voordelen hebben voor bedrijven. Door API’s te gebruiken kunnen bedrijven het voor hun klanten gemakkelijker maken om toegang te krijgen tot hun diensten en producten. Dit kan bedrijven helpen om te groeien en hun bereik uit te breiden.

“Het mooie van een API is dat je een duidelijk overzicht hebt van welke data je kan opvragen en wat je terug krijgt. Tevens kun je meerdere applicaties laten praten met één API omgeving.”

Theo, Sr. Full Stack Developer

3. Hoe werken API’s?

Deze communicatie tussen de applicaties gebeurt door het gebruik van specifieke protocollen, die verschillende toepassingen in staat stellen elkaar te begrijpen. Er zijn veel verschillende types API’s. API’s kunnen programmageoriënteerd zijn zoals Java, maar ook webgebaseerd zoals Simple Object Access Protocol (SOAP), Remote Procedure Call (RPC) of Representational State Transfer (REST). Volgens Programmable Web zijn er momenteel meer dan vijfduizend publiek beschikbare API’s en nog duizenden meer intern gebruikte API’s. Je kunt dus ook je eigen API creëren. Belangrijk is dat de API dan van hoogwaardige kwaliteit is en veilig is ingericht.

 

“Je moet er wel voor zorgen dat je gevoelige data alleen beschikbaar stelt na authenticatie. Een verkeerde implementatie kan er voor zorgen dat er meer data beschikbaar wordt gesteld dan wenselijk”

Theo, Sr. Full Stack Developer

Kortom, API’s zijn een waardevol en nuttig hulpmiddel voor bedrijven, omdat zij een gemakkelijke manier bieden om verschillende toepassingen met elkaar te verbinden. Het succes van een API schuilt in de juiste toepassing ervan, de kwaliteit en veiligheid. Als je geïnteresseerd bent in meer informatie over hoe jouw bedrijf de kracht van API’s kan toepassen, of hulp wilt bij de implementatie ervan in je eigen strategie, dan helpen wij graag. Maak een afspraak en kom direct in contact met een van onze IT experts.